Energy efficiency

Double-glazed windows can make your home more energy efficient. They will keep your home warmer in winter and cooler in summer. They will also help reduce your utility bills. These windows can help you save up to 12% on your energy bills annually.

A double-glazed window is one that has two panes hermetically sealed. Each pane is separated by a spacer and the space is then filled with an inert gas (usually argon or krypton). These gases are used as insulation, which helps keep heat in your home. Double-glazed windows are more efficient than windows with a single pane.

window repairs near me , the size and the type of glazing are all aspects that affect the energy efficiency. For example, uPVC frames are more energy efficient than timber and aluminium. Also, the argon or Krypton gas filling in the gaps between the glass panes will dramatically reduce your energy costs.

Security

Double glazing can improve your security at home by making it harder for burglars to break into your home. Single glass panes, timber or aluminum windows are easily broken by skilled or opportunistic thieves. Double glazing is made up of two panes of glass and locking mechanisms that are more resistant to break. This makes it much more difficult for burglars to break into your home or business. They can also be prevented from damaging valuable objects and taking them.

Double-glazed windows are constructed from two glass panes with a space between them, which is sealed together inside a unit called an IGU (insulated glazing unit). The glass is laminated or tempered to provide strength and the gap is filled with air or, more often, the gas argon. It is a non-toxic, inert gas with no odour and has excellent insulation properties.

There are a myriad of alternatives for glass, such as tints, UV blockers, and low-e films, which are energy efficient. Upgrade to toughened safety glasses which are up to five times stronger than ordinary glass. This lowers the risk of injury, especially in young children.

The cost of double-glazed windows depends on the design and frame material you select and also the cost of installation. uPVC frames tend to be the least expensive, followed by aluminum and then timber.
